HTML语义化的重要性与实践指南
发布时间: 2024-03-06 04:53:09 阅读量: 8 订阅数: 10
# 1. HTML语义化的基础概念
## 1.1 什么是HTML语义化
HTML语义化是指按照标签的语义恰当地选择标签,使其更具有可读性、结构良好和便于理解的特点。通过合理地选择语义化标签,可以使网页结构更加清晰明了,而不仅仅是为了样式而存在。
在HTML中,语义化标签指的是那些表现语义而不是样式的HTML标签,如`<header>`、`<nav>`、`<article>`、`<section>`等。
## 1.2 HTML语义化的作用和意义
- 提升网页的可读性:使用语义化标签可以让网页结构更加清晰,方便开发者和维护者理解网页内容。
- 有利于SEO优化:搜索引擎能更好地理解页面的内容和结构,有助于提升网站在搜索结果中的排名。
- 方便其他设备解析:如屏幕阅读器、爬虫等工具可以更好地解析页面,提升用户体验。
## 1.3 为什么需要关注HTML语义化
关注HTML语义化能够带来诸多好处,包括但不限于提升网页性能、SEO优化、可访问性、代码可维护性等方面的提升。在多人协作开发中,良好的HTML语义化能够有效提高团队开发效率,减少沟通成本,使项目更易于维护和扩展。
# 2. HTML语义化对SEO的影响
在本章中,我们将深入探讨HTML语义化如何影响搜索引擎优化(SEO),以及如何利用HTML语义化提升网站的SEO效果。同时,我们将通过实例分析具体展示HTML语义化对SEO的作用。让我们一起来探究吧!
### 2.1 HTML语义化如何影响搜索引擎对网页的理解
搜索引擎通过检索网页内容,了解页面结构和内容来确定网页的排名。HTML语义化可以帮助搜索引擎更好地理解网页内容和结构。使用语义化标签如`<header>`、`<nav>`、`<main>`、`<article>`、`<section>`等能够为页面内容赋予更明确的含义,提高搜索引擎对页面的解读能力,从而影响网页的排名。
### 2.2 如何通过HTML语义化提升网站的SEO效果
通过合理使用语义化标签,并结合良好的内容结构和关键字优化,可以有效提升网站的SEO效果。合理使用标题标签`<h1>`到`<h6>`,保证每个页面有一个唯一的`<h1>`标签;使用`<nav>`标签定义导航;使用`<article>`标签定义主要内容等,都能够对SEO产生积极影响。
### 2.3 实例分析:HTML语义化对SEO的具体作用
```html
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ta http-equiv="X-UA-Compatible" content="IE=edge">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>HTML语义化对SEO的作用示例</title>
</head>
<body>
<header>
<h1>优质文章标题</h1>
</header>
<nav>
<ul>
<li><a href="#">首页</a></li>
<li><a href="#">关于我们</a></li>
<li><a href="#">联系我们</a></li>
</ul>
</nav>
<main>
<article>
<h2>文章内容标题</h2>
<p>这里是文章内容...</p>
</article>
</main>
<footer>
<p>© 2022 版权所有</p>
</footer>
</body>
</html>
```
**代码总结:**
- 通过使用`<header>`、`<nav>`、`<main>`、`<article>`等语义化标签,明确页面结构,提升页面的语义化。
- 合理使用标题标签和结构标签,有助于搜索引擎更好地理解页面内容,提高网站的SEO效果。
**结果说明:**
- 上述示例代码展示了一个简单的页面结构,并合理使用了语义化标签,有助于搜索引擎更好地解析和理解页面内容,从而提升网站的SEO效果。
# 3. 语义化标签的使用指南
在Web开发中,使用合适的HTML语义化标签可以让页面结构更加清晰、
0
0